Job Description

Logistics Coordination & Shipment Management

  • Coordinate shipments of chemicals ( Liquid- dry) , ensuring compliance with regulations and company policies.
  • Communicate with internal stakeholders in the U.S. , India & Egypt and service providers to manage shipment logistics.
  • Manage shipments, ( Containers- ISO Tanks- LCL- AIR – OTR-etc. ) including monitoring, documentation, and delivery coordination.
  • Work with freight forwarders, ocean carriers’ customs brokers-warehouse and all involved parties to schedule pick-ups, deliveries, and customs clearance, etc.
  • Maintain accurate shipment records, track deliveries, and provide regular updates using various tools and Excel metrics.
  • Update shipment tracking systems with latest and accurate information.

Trade Compliance & Regulatory Adherence

  • Ensure compliance with domestic and international trade regulations, including MSDS, Hazmat Documents, etc COA- COO
  • Work with involved areas to obtain all the required information for customs clearance for company import shipments and direct to customers in the US and the Americas.
  • Prepare necessary customs documentation, including invoices, packing lists, and compliance certifications.

Warehouse & Inventory Management

  • Work with warehouse providers regarding, receipts, shipment requests, returns, special projects.
  • Track inventory changes, analyze reports, and ensure priority projects receive necessary materials.
  • Work with warehouse partners to resolve issues and ensure smooth material handling operations.
  • Participate in annual inventory counts/audits

Vendor & Supplier Coordination

  • Identify alternative shipping vendors and solutions when primary providers are unavailable.
  • Assist with vendor onboarding,
  • Collaborate with internal and external partners to troubleshoot operational challenges.

General Administration & Compliance

  • Participate in training programs and stay up to date on industry regulations.
  • Attend virtual meetings across different time zones to collaborate with global teams.
  • Travel domestically and internationally to sites, including service providers or customer facilities as required.
  • Facilitate communication across logistics related parties and drive collaboration
  • Monitor daily, weekly, and monthly operations KPI performance and report status
  • Assist with additional tasks to support logistics and compliance functions.

Qualifications:

  • Bachelor’s degree
  • 3 to 5+ years of work experience in Logistics and Operations teams, supply chain or related field, or an equivalent combination of education and experience.
  • Experience with International transportation ( Ocean Carriers/ Freight forwarding trucking.)
  • Knowledge of global trade regulations, hazardous materials,
